グローバル メモリ ブロックを割り当て、指定形式で HGLOBAL にデータを取得します。
HGLOBAL GetGlobalData(
CLIPFORMAT cfFormat,
LPFORMATETC lpFormatEtc = NULL
);
パラメーター
cfFormat
返されるデータの形式。 このパラメーターには、定義済みのクリップボード形式、または Windows ネイティブの RegisterClipboardFormat 関数が返す値を指定できます。lpFormatEtc
返されるデータの形式を示す FORMATETC 構造体へのポインター。 cfFormat で指定されたクリップボード形式に追加の形式情報を指定するときは、このパラメーターを指定します。 パラメーターが NULL のときは、FORMATETC 構造体のほかのフィールドには既定の値が使われます。
戻り値
正常終了した場合は、データを保持しているグローバル メモリ ブロックのハンドルを返します。それ以外の場合は NULL を返します。
解説
詳細については、Windows SDK の「FORMATETC」を参照してください。
詳細については、Windows SDK の「RegisterClipboardFormat」を参照してください。
必要条件
**ヘッダー:**afxole.h
参照
参照
COleDataObject::IsDataAvailable